How to choose a pineapple

How to choose a pineapple

You have to know how to choose the right pineapple. First, you should pay special attention to the freshness of the pineapple leaves and the color of their skin. The leaves should pull out easily, if not, it means that the pineapple is not ripe yet. You can buy it, but only if you want it to ripen for a while. The fresh and ripe fruit should have a golden color. The dull color of the pineapple indicates it has been stored for a long time and is no longer fit for consumption, it is spoiled. A good ripe pineapple has a much richer flavor and sweetness than a canned one. Cutting the hard, bumpy rind (not to mention the inedible core) of pineapple can seem like a daunting task. In fact, there is a very simple method of peeling the pineapple rind.

When shopping, choose a pineapple that has a firm, golden brown rind (not too green) with green loose leaves (not brown or shriveled). A ripe pineapple will have a strong, fresh pineapple smell.

To peel the pineapple, you will need a long knife.

Cut off the top and bottom of the pineapple

Cut off the top and bottom of the pineapple

Twist or cut off the leaves and about an inch and a half off the top and bottom of the pineapple. If you like, you can use the top and leaves as part of the table decoration.

Turn the pineapple upright

Turn the pineapple upright

Place the pineapple vertically on its base. Notice the dark brown “eyes” along the edge of the pineapple. They run along with the pineapple and have a very unpleasant taste.

The first pineapple cut — Peeling

The first pineapple cut — Peeling

Place your knife on top of the fruit just behind one of the “eyes. Cut the skin of the fruit from top to bottom, turning the knife slightly from the top and bottom, circling the shape of the pineapple.

The results of your first pineapple cut

The results of your first pineapple cut

The first cut you make will be wider than the next. Note the rows of eyes on each side of the cut.

Final cleaning of pineapple

Final cleaning of pineapple

Cut off the rest of the pineapple skin, cutting from top to bottom along each row of eyes. Your knife should be behind the eyes at about a 45-degree angle. Don’t try to cut too many peels at once.

Peeled pineapple

Peeled pineapple

After you have completely peeled the pineapple, check the fruit for any peels or eyes you may have missed. Remove any remaining eyes with a vegetable peeler. If you want to cut the pineapple into rings, remove the core and slice to your desired thickness.

Pineapple core extraction — Step 1

Pineapple core extraction — Step 1

If you want to cut the pineapple into slices or chunks, first cut the pineapple into four pieces. Cut straight through the center core.

Removing the pineapple kernel — Step 2

Removing the pineapple kernel — Step 2

Cut off the core by trimming it to length. The core is easy to distinguish from the edible fruit because it is lighter and fibrous in texture. Repeat with the remaining quarters.

Pineapple cubes

Pineapple cubes

Once the core has been removed, slice the pineapple into desired sizes. Store by placing in an airtight container and place in the refrigerator.
